Detail of the stay : Seoul and its region - 7 days
Day 1: Discovery of Seoul
Steps: Seoul
Visit of one of the palaces in Seoul (mainly Gyeongbokgung, Changdeokgung and Deoksugung), walk in Myeong-dong and the Namdaemun market (smaller but much more typical than Dongdaemun).

Day 2: Seoul, between modernity and traditions
Steps: Seoul
Visit of one of the three main palaces not visited. Visit of the folk village of Namsan. Walk in Apgujeong-dong.

Day 3: Balad in the lively neighborhoods of Seoul
Steps: Seoul
Walk in Insadong (preferably Sunday when the street is lively) and Bukchon. Visit of one of the unvisited palaces. Exit in western student districts.
Day 4: Departure for a high place of Confucianism
Departure for Andong (about 4 hours train), its folk village and Confucian academies, including Dosan Seowon.
Day 5: Travel over time in Kyeongju
Day in Kyeongju (remains of the kingdom of Silla, Bulguksa temple, Seokguram cave).
Day 6: Serenity in Haïensa
End of visit to Kyeongju. Departure for Haïensa near Daegu. It is better to sleep there.
